DOES VIAGRA MAKE YOU LAST LONGER IN BED?
We’ve heard plenty of tall stories about Viagra. About men who’ve had erections for hours. About lads who stay hard after climaxing and those who are transformed into sexual tyrannosaurs. Any truth in them? Not really.
Viagra – also available as the generic drug sildenafil – is a prescription medication developed and tested to treat erectile dysfunction (ED). It’s exactly that – an ED treatment. It’s not a lifestyle drug that generally improves your sexual performance or a treatment developed for premature ejaculation.
But there has been some research conducted into this area. The results aren’t promising though guys. One study of 180 men with premature ejaculation found that Viagra did cause a modest increase in the time the men lasted before ejaculation. But other studies have failed to repeat this finding. The reality is that Viagra is not an effective premature ejaculation treatment for most men.
WHAT DOES VIAGRA DO?
Viagra improves the flow of blood to the penis, making it easier to get and keep an erection. This is what Viagra was made to do. Scientific research has shown it can have other benefits too such as:
Viagra may help you get an erection faster again after an orgasm. Your refractory period is the time it takes you to recover after an orgasm and to be able to get an erection again. A number of studies showed that Viagra can reduce a man’s refractory period. This effect wasn’t always found consistently in research however so Viagra may affect some men this way but not others.

Extra Time is back with a brand new album titled "Songs With Long Titles."
Extra Time's most recent studio album is titled "Songs with Long Titles."
With 12 tracks in its set list, the album serves as a varied showcase of what Extra Time is all about. The combination of genres and sounds on this release is incredibly impressive. From alternative music, to psychedelic rock, pop-rock and even folk, anything goes. The opening track, "Where Is The Light" swiftly combines jazz with rock, immediately placing this album in a league of its ow in terms of variety of vision. "The Lost Man" is another outstanding track, with its jangly guitar tones and personal lyrics, as well as its expertly layered vocals. "Mr. Winton" shows yet another side of Extra Time's creativity, with hypnotic piano patterns and emotional strings over an intricate drum beat that brings more sophistication to this arrangement. It is not always easy to bring so many different styles together, but this seems to be the true strength of Extra Time's sound, as well as a defining factor of this release.
Overall, "Songs with Long Titles" stands out for its strong creative direction and high production standards. Each track is meticulously crafted, showcasing a balanced and immersive tone with so many layers to unfold!
